
Highly anticipated sequel 'Dhurandhar: The Revenge' will hit theatres worldwide on March 19. The trailer of the film was released by Ranveer Singh on social media. Reports suggest that bookings will also begin in India after the trailer launch. The film will be released on March 19 in languages like Hindi, Telugu, Tamil, Kannada, and Malayalam. The high-octane action-filled trailer, which is three minutes long, has already surpassed a million views on social media, even within an hour of its release.
With four hours of running time, there is a possibility that the daily shows may be limited. To address this, theatre chains are also considering introducing premium ticket prices called Super Blockbuster Plus. The price will be 10 per cent to 25 per cent more than the regular ticket prices. There are also indications that efforts are being made at the editing table to reduce the movie's length to three hours and 30 minutes.
With Yash starrer 'Toxic' being pushed to June 4, Dhurandhar is expected to wield total dominance at the box office. However, Ryan Gosling's Hollywood film 'Project Hail Mary', which is releasing on March 20, could pose a challenge to Ranveer's film. Apart from Ranveer Singh, Sara Arjun, Sanjay Dutt, R. Madhavan and Arjun Rampal are playing lead roles in Dhurandhar.
